PANX2 (HGNC:8600): (pannexin 2) The protein encoded by this gene belongs to the innexin family. Innexin family members are the structural components of gap junctions. This protein and pannexin 1 are abundantly expressed in central nervous system (CNS) and are coexpressed in various neuronal populations. Studies in Xenopus oocytes suggest that this protein alone and in combination with pannexin 1 may form cell type-specific gap junctions with distinct properties. Multiple transcript variants encoding different isoforms have been found for this gene. [provided by RefSeq, May 2009]

The c.115G>A (p.A39T) alteration is located in exon 1 (coding exon 1) of the PANX2 gene. This alteration results from a G to A substitution at nucleotide position 115, causing the alanine (A) at amino acid position 39 to be replaced by a threonine (T). Based on insufficient or conflicting evidence, the clinical significance of this alteration remains unclear. -
